EV uptake in the North of England has more than doubled

The latest data from the Department for Transport (DfT) shows that electric vehicle uptake in the North of England has more than doubled since 2020, with EV registrations in the region reaching 74,677 in 2021.

Throughout the UK, there are now more than a quarter of a million electric vehicles on the roads and there was a 77 per cent rise in new plug-in vehicles registered in 2021 (327,000). 

Transport Secretary Grant Shapps said, “The UK continues to be a global front-runner in the switch to electric vehicles – helping drivers to save money on fuel while moving towards our net zero targets.”

The Transport Secretary recently confirmed a £500 million funding package to ‘transform’ local on-street charging facilities throughout the UK in pursuit of the government’s aim to reach 300,000 public EV chargepoints. 

A recent study by electric car website Electrifying.com, found a major disparity in price between the use of public charging infrastructure (around £91.75 a month) and off-street charging (around £13.75) over the same time period.
